How much does a Statistician make in Detroit, MI? The average Statistician salary in Detroit, MI is $106,721 as of March 01, 2025, but the salary range typically falls between $92,144 and $121,201.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. These charts show the average base salary (core compensation), as well as the average total cash compensation for the job of Statistician in Detroit, MI. The base salary for Statistician ranges from $92,144 to $121,201 with the average base salary of $106,721. The total cash compensation, which includes base, and annual incentives, can vary anywhere from $95,030 to $127,557 with the average total cash compensation of $111,044.
